It's easy to go wrong in a job interview. But after investing all the effort into developing a resume and cover letter that gets you in the door for an interview, you don't want to blow it when you’re finally face to face with the hiring manager, do you?
Don't worry; follow these few tips for interviews and you'll be on your way to interview success!
Things You SHOULD Do
Arrive on time—or better yet—10 minutes early
Refer to the interviewer by name
Smile and use a firm handshake
Be alert and act interested throughout
Maintain eye contact at all times
Make all comments in a positive manner
Speak clearly, firmly, and with authority
Accept any refreshment offered
Promote your strengths
Things You Should NOT Do
Be overly aggressive or egotistical
Spend too much time talking about money
Act uninterested in the company or the job
Act defensively when questioned about anything
Speak badly about past colleagues or employers
Answer with only yes or no
Excuse your bad points about work history
Ask for coffee or refreshments
Excuse yourself halfway through the interview, even if you have to use the bathroom
